SLM Debuts AHRMM14 Video in Orlando
This month, another SolidLine-produced video debuted on huge screens down in Orlando . The Association for Healthcare Resource and Materials Management (ARHMM) wanted a video to kick off their member conference, and SolidLine certainly delivered an attention-grabbing, fully animated & fun production. The theme of the conference was "Reignite Your Imagination," so the video needed to set the tone of encouraging conference-goers to think outside of the box and use their imaginations like they did when they were kids. Our crew had a blast producing the video, which was a hit at AHRMM14, and it looked great on the big screens. Make sure you check it out via the play button below!
"This year we set out to kick off the AHRMM annual conference with a call to action, to get our members to reignite their imaginations and start to think differently about the healthcare supply chain," exclaims Debbie Sprindzunas, AHRMM Executive Director. "SolidLine was amazing to work with during the entire creative and development process. They created a unique and fun animated video concept that certainly made this imagination come to life. The production set the tone for the entire week and was a perfect intro to the conference!"

Now Accepting Resumes for Internship
Over the past several years, SolidLine's internship program has become quite popular with students across the country. The three & a half month full-time program is a rigorous exposure into the production business and comes with great responsibility. SLM interns are on the front lines of production and not just sitting around making coffee for the rest of the crew. They travel the world for on-location shoots, assist with editing, and learn what it takes to produce a video from start to finish while running a successful business in the Chicago loop.
